Complex yet crushabull, our new Lucky's Lager is inspired by the past, present, and future of Durham.

PAST
Lagers are so much more than mass-market light beer. We're especially drawn to the rich history of European lagers, particularly the Czech Amber Lager. Its lightly toasty notes echo Durham’s heritage in tobacco processing and manufacturing.

Some of us have been here long enough to remember when downtown Durham smelled of sweet, toasted tobacco. While we didn’t aim for an exact replica (and this isn’t a smoked lager), our Director of Brewery Operations, Jon Simpson, wanted to brew a beer that captures Durham’s sense of place—something thoughtful and intentional, not just another "crispy boi."

Alc. By Vol.
5.2%
IBU
24
To-Go Options
16oz Cans
Drink It With
N.C. barbecue
Grains Pale Malt, Riverbend Crystal 50, Riverbend Light Munich, Epiphany Ruby, Locally malted barley (Brewer's Breakfast Biscuit)
Hops Saaz
Yeast Omega German Lager
